Archbishop of Canterbury who opposed Henry II of England, and was killed in Canterbury Cathedral by two knights from Henry's court, in 1170.

Dated to between 1194 and 1230, this sculpture at Chartres Cathedral is on the left pillar of the left portal of the south porch. It depicts the martyrdom of St Thomas Becket who was killed, by two knights from the court of Henry II, in Canterbury Cathedral.

Mid 14th century mural of St Thomas Beckett on a south nave pillar at St Albans Cathedral. The right hand is raised in a blessing, whilst the in the left hand is the bishop's staff.
